According to the results of a survey conducted in the United States in October 2023, about 33 percent of respondents aged 30 to 44 years old stated that they considered themselves Taylor Swift fans. More than one in 10 survey respondents aged 65 years or older stated the same.
The phenomenon of Taylor Swift
Since her first album in 2006, Taylor Swift has managed to build a global brand around her music. According to an analysis from 2023, she officially became a billionaire after making approximately 370 million U.S. dollars through ticket sales and merchandise. Another main component of her income is the release and re-release of her music. However, 2023 seemed to be the year of Taylor Swift in other regards as well. Her Eras Tour, which she launched in March, grossed over one billion U.S. dollars, becoming the highest grossing tour of all time. Additionally, it is estimated that Swift even boosted the U.S. economy with her tour, by 5.7 billion U.S. dollar Yet, she did not stop there, turning her tour into a concert film, which quickly became the most successful concert film in history. By the end of the year, she was Spotify’s most streamed artist globally and subsequently Time Magazine named her “Person of the Year”.
